What Are Plug-and-Play Trackers?

A plug-and-play tracker is a small GPS device designed to connect directly to your vehicle's On-Board Diagnostics (OBD-II) port. This rectangular port is a standard feature in most cars manufactured after 2000 and is usually found under the dashboard near the steering wheel. The beauty of these devices is their simplicity - they don’t require tools, wiring, or professional installation. Just plug them in, and they draw power from the vehicle's electrical system. Even if the device is disconnected or the car's battery fails, an internal backup battery keeps it running. Besides tracking your vehicle's location, these trackers can pull engine diagnostics and other data straight from the car's computer.

One of the standout benefits of plug-and-play trackers is their portability. They can be moved between vehicles in a matter of minutes, making them perfect for leased fleets, temporary contractors, or businesses that frequently replace vehicles.

What Are Hardwired Trackers?

When it comes to safeguarding high-value vehicles, hardwired trackers provide a sturdy and reliable solution. Unlike plug-and-play trackers that connect to the OBD-II port, hardwired trackers are permanently installed into the vehicle's electrical system. This involves a three-wire connection - power, ignition, and ground - and typically requires a skilled auto-electrician to fit them discreetly, often behind the dashboard or under the bonnet. Once installed, they’re virtually invisible, and the process usually takes 30 to 60 minutes per vehicle. This integration not only enhances reliability but also boosts security.

Being soldered into place makes these trackers highly resistant to tampering, whether by drivers or thieves. Designed for both 12V and 24V systems, they draw power continuously and include an internal backup battery to keep them running even if disconnected. This ensures uninterrupted operation and adds an extra layer of security. Tamper detection mechanisms further strengthen their reliability.

"The hardwired unit has tamper detection as it's soldered into place – any interruption would be noticed. This ensures that if someone tries to interfere with a tracker, you as the fleet manager will know about it." - Quartix

Despite their compact size (9cm × 5.5cm × 2.4cm, weighing just 90g), these devices are built to endure tough conditions. Many models come with IP67-rated casings, offering protection against water, dust, and extreme temperatures ranging from -20°C to +60°C.

Features of Hardwired Trackers

Hardwired trackers don’t just offer secure installation - they also come packed with features tailored for fleet management. For instance, they support engine immobilisation, enabling you to remotely disable a vehicle's starter in case of theft. Other advanced functionalities include geofencing, fuel monitoring, and detailed engine diagnostics.

These trackers can also monitor additional equipment via digital inputs. For example, fleets operating refrigerated lorries, construction vehicles, or emergency service vehicles can track the status of tailgate lifts, emergency doors, temperature sensors, or Power Take-Off (PTO) systems. Driver identification is another handy feature, often achieved through key fobs or iButton readers.

Installation and Maintenance Comparison

Installing plug-and-play trackers versus hardwired ones is a completely different experience. Plug-and-play devices are straightforward: just connect the unit to your vehicle's OBD-II port (usually found under the steering wheel) or clip it onto the battery terminals. No tools, no technical skills, and no professional help are required. The whole process takes about 5 to 10 minutes.

On the other hand, hardwired trackers demand professional installation. A trained auto-electrician integrates the device into your vehicle’s electrical system by connecting it to the power, ignition, and ground wires. This often involves working behind the dashboard or under the bonnet using tools like a voltage meter, wire cutters, and screwdrivers. The process typically takes between 30 and 60 minutes per vehicle.

"Self-install plug & play devices can be installed by the user and set up in a matter of minutes, so if time off the roads is a serious concern, this will likely be the best option for your business." - Fleetsmart

Installation Time and Tools Required

For plug-and-play trackers, no tools are needed. Simply locate the OBD-II port, plug in the device until it clicks, or attach it to the battery terminals. This simplicity makes them a great choice for small fleet industries or leased vehicles where trackers might need to be swapped frequently.

Hardwired trackers, however, require a technician to access your vehicle's wiring. They’ll identify the correct power and ignition wires and connect the tracker securely using methods like "poke and wrap" wiring. Providers usually recommend setting aside an hour for installation to allow for proper testing, which means some unavoidable vehicle downtime. The upside? Hardwired trackers are installed discreetly and are harder to tamper with.

Feature Differences Between Plug-and-Play and Hardwired Trackers

Expanding on the differences in installation and maintenance, here’s a closer look at how plug-and-play and hardwired trackers stack up in terms of functionality and features.

One of the biggest distinctions lies in the level of integration. Hardwired trackers can connect directly to your vehicle's internal systems, allowing them to monitor detailed components like Power Take-Off (PTO), beacon lights, and even seatbelt usage through physical wire connections. This makes them a better fit for businesses needing in-depth operational insights. On the other hand, plug-and-play trackers are generally limited to basics such as engine diagnostics, mileage tracking, and ignition status.

Security is another area where these two tracker types differ. Hardwired trackers are installed discreetly behind the dashboard, making them much harder for potential thieves - or even drivers - to locate and tamper with. Plug-and-play trackers, however, are plugged into the easily accessible OBD-II port, meaning they can be removed in seconds. While many plug-and-play models are designed to send tamper alerts if disconnected, their visibility still makes them more vulnerable to deliberate removal.

"Hardwired trackers are positioned underneath the hood/dash of the vehicle and well out of sight of any occupant." - Azuga

When it comes to power reliability, hardwired systems have the upper hand. These trackers draw power directly from your vehicle's electrical system, maintaining consistent performance without interruptions. Plug-and-play devices, however, depend on the OBD-II port connection, which can sometimes become loose or disconnected. Additionally, hardwired systems support advanced features like remote engine immobilisation, door unlocking, and driver ID verification using key fobs.

Pros and Cons of Plug-and-Play Trackers

After looking at their features and installation process, it's worth weighing the main benefits and drawbacks of plug-and-play trackers.

Plug-and-play trackers shine when it comes to quick setup and portability. You can install one in as little as 5 to 10 minutes, with no tools or professional help required. This means you can have your fleet up and running in just a few hours. Plus, you save on professional installation costs, which usually range from £40 to £120 per vehicle. Their portability is another big win - these devices can be switched between vehicles in seconds, making them especially useful for fleets with high turnover, leased vehicles, or seasonal rentals.

Another perk is their cost-effectiveness. These trackers are budget-friendly, both in terms of hardware and subscription fees. Despite their lower cost, they still provide essential features like engine diagnostics through the OBD-II port.

However, there are some notable downsides. The most significant is their vulnerability to tampering. Since these trackers connect via the exposed OBD-II port, they can be easily unplugged by anyone, including drivers. As Teletrac Navman UK explains:

"Easy to install means easy to remove. Since these devices are not securely hardwired to the vehicle, removing them is easy, which makes stolen vehicle tracking nearly impossible" (see our van tracker systems for recovery statistics).

Another limitation is their reduced functionality compared to hardwired systems. Plug-and-play trackers lack external input/output ports, so they can't monitor specialised equipment like snowploughs, Power Take-Off systems, or door sensors. Additionally, because they occupy the OBD-II port, they may interfere with other diagnostic tools that need the same connection.

Security and Reliability Comparison

When it comes to safeguarding your fleet against theft and tampering, hardwired trackers stand out as the more secure option. These trackers are discreetly installed behind the dashboard or under the bonnet, making them virtually invisible. Because they are directly integrated into the vehicle’s electrical system, locating and removing them is a challenge. As Quartix explains:

"The unit is completely hidden from view following installation... any interruption would be noticed".

In contrast, plug-and-play trackers are much more exposed. Installed in the easily accessible OBD-II port, they can be unplugged in seconds, leaving the vehicle untracked. Teletrac Navman UK highlights this vulnerability:

"Since these devices are not securely hardwired to the vehicle, removing them is easy, which makes stolen vehicle tracking nearly impossible".

Both systems offer tamper alerts, but they work differently. Hardwired trackers detect disruptions like power loss or wire cutting, immediately notifying fleet managers. On the other hand, plug-and-play devices send an alert when unplugged, but tracking ceases instantly. Despite these differences, both types maintain reliable power connections, thanks to direct vehicle power and backup batteries that keep the system running for hours, even during power interruptions.

Best Use Cases for Each Tracker Type

If you manage small fleets or leased vehicles, plug-and-play trackers are a practical choice. These devices can be quickly installed and transferred between vehicles without requiring any permanent changes. Their portability makes them ideal for high-turnover vehicles and temporary projects. For instance, you can easily deploy them for short-term hires and retrieve them once the project ends, all without altering the vehicle. This makes them especially handy for subcontractor fleets where flexibility is key [2, 11].

On the other hand, hardwired trackers are the go-to option when security is a top priority. These systems are perfect for permanently owned fleets, high-value assets, and operations in areas where theft is a concern. Installed discreetly behind the dashboard or under the bonnet, they’re tamper-resistant and offer a robust level of protection. They’re also well-suited for heavy machinery, HGVs, and plant equipment, especially when you need to monitor specialised components like tail-lifts, emergency doors, or PTO (Power Take-Off) status [13, 3, 6].

If your fleet includes a mix of vehicle types, a hybrid approach might be the best solution. For core, company-owned vehicles requiring advanced telematics and enhanced security, hardwired systems are a solid choice. Meanwhile, plug-and-play devices can be deployed for subcontractor, hired, or seasonal vehicles. This approach strikes a balance between cost efficiency and operational flexibility.

When deciding on a tracker, it’s essential to consider both operational needs and insurance requirements. For example, if your insurance policy mandates Thatcham certification for coverage or discounts, plug-and-play devices won’t meet the criteria. In such cases, you’ll need a professionally installed hardwired system to comply [4, 5].

What happens to data if a plug-and-play tracker is unplugged?

Plug-and-play trackers draw power from a vehicle’s OBD-II port or 12V socket. If they’re unplugged, the live data feed stops. However, many modern trackers come with a small internal backup battery. This handy feature keeps the tracker running for a few hours, storing GPS data locally. Once power is restored, the device uploads the saved data to the telematics platform, ensuring minimal data gaps.

If the backup battery runs out or the tracker stays offline for too long, it will be marked as "offline". When power and a stable signal are available again, the tracker reconnects and uploads any stored location data.
